Longtime Fox News host Sean Hannity on Tuesday torched his own network’s polling unit as he sparred with Bill de Blasio on the midterm elections.

The former New York City mayor named five key Democrats who he said will win their elections in November, including James Talarico, the Democratic candidate in Texas running against scandal-plagued state Attorney General Ken Paxton.

A Democrat hasn’t won a statewide race in the deep red state in decades, but de Blasio predicted that Talarico will pull it off.

As Hannity began spouting a bunch of right-wing talking points against Talarico, de Blasio stepped in with a reality check based on the latest Fox News polling numbers.

“Did you read your own poll today where Talarico is beating Paxton?” de Blasio asked.

The poll, actually from last week, had Talarico ahead of Paxton, 51-48. It was one of several polls in recent weeks to give the Democratic candidate the edge.

“I don’t believe it for two seconds,” Hannity fired back.

Democrats are widely expected to take control of the House in November’s elections. The Senate, on the other hand, was once considered a long shot with a map that favored Republicans keeping their slim majority in the chamber. However, recent polls show a path for Democrats ― and a Talarico victory in Texas would be key to those chances.
